We use CAD/CAM Cerec technology and porcelain (full-ceramic) materials. CAD/CAM stands for “computer-aided design / computer-aided manufacturing.” Our dentists use CAD/CAM systems to design and create crowns, bridges, dentures, and other prostheses more quickly, than was possible to do before. Using advanced 3D printing technology, CAD/CAM turns a computer model into physical reality. This system enables us to provide treatments, such as crowns and veneers, in one visit. In some cases, our dentists recommend using zirconium material for higher durability of the tooth. Then we need 2-3 days for the production.

Porcelain dental crowns are tooth-shaped caps that are placed over your tooth. The crown restores the tooth´s shape, size, strength, and appearance. The dental crown is cemented into place on your tooth and covers the visible portion of the tooth. We will help you to protect your tooth from further damage or infection.

4) DENTAL IMPLANTS IN PRAGUE

Creating high-quality dental implants is a long process. In Prague clinic, Praga Medica 3D scan is taken, from which the condition of the bone is determined. If the patient does not have enough bone, the bone must be added. The wound is then healed, and the dental implant is fixed into the bone. Only then is the final crown placed.

The treatment of the implant lasts minimum 4 month in the easiest scenarios when no bone augmentation is needed. It is necessary to come to Prague in minimum for 2, more likely for 3 visits to finalise the treatment. Therefore, it is necessary to take into account the fact that it is necessary to come to Prague repeatedly, three times, and it is necessary to take into account the increased costs.

5) COMPUTER GUIDED DENTAL IMPLANTATION

Computer-guided dental implant placement uses advanced technology to allow oral surgeons to precisely place the new teeth for patients. A computer program and cone-beam CT will be used for planning an accurate position of dental implants. The computer program will combine x-ray images, impressions, and cone-beam CT images and translate them into a 3D model of the jaw. The dentist will be able to visualize the placement of dental implants and determine their optimum position with a high degree of accuracy. This treatment enables us to maximize the accuracy of the implantation and minimize the pain and healing time needed.

During the first visit to Prague – Praga Medica, if you need crowns or veneers (not implants), we always start with a panoramic X-ray to examine the exact condition of your teeth. Our highly specialized dentist would take a digital scan of your tooth and suggests the best treatment for you. It takes 2-3 hours to prepare the crown in our on-site laboratory. The completed crown must be tried on to ensure that fits perfectly before the final fixation. Sometimes the dentist needs more days to produce the crowns for your teeth based on every client’s complexity and individual needs. Usually, the treatment is completed in 1-3 days.

With the CEREC machine, we have the laboratory on-site. It is a 3D tooth printer that can prepare an entire jawbone in 1 day. It’s challenging. First, the tooth has to be lightly ground down, so there is also room to place a ceramic crown or veneer filling to make it look as natural as possible. Grinding of the right one is done minimally. It is a delicate process that aims to interfere as little as possible with the natural tooth.

When the artificial teeth are made, the client gets a “first try on,” a test where the tooth is fixed with a temporary adhesive. Only when the client has verified that the shape and appearance of the tooth suits and fits, can work be done on the shade of white of the tooth. When the client is satisfied with the final result of the tooth, the new tooth is fixed with permanent cement. This fixation is firm, like a natural tooth. At this stage, the step cannot be undone.

The next day, our dentists work on the other jaw in the same way. In the end, the so-called bite checkup takes place, and the final corrections are made to the bite so that it fits ideally and the client can bite and eat comfortably.
